Spaces:
Running
Running
asigalov61
commited on
Commit
•
be246c9
1
Parent(s):
fef53cb
Update app.py
Browse files
app.py
CHANGED
@@ -152,9 +152,9 @@ if __name__ == "__main__":
|
|
152 |
input_patch = gr.Slider(0, 127, value=40, step=1, label="Melody MIDI patch")
|
153 |
input_start_chord = gr.Slider(0, 128, value=0, step=1, label="Melody start chord")
|
154 |
|
155 |
-
run_btn = gr.Button("
|
156 |
|
157 |
-
gr.Markdown("##
|
158 |
|
159 |
output_midi_title = gr.Textbox(label="Output MIDI title")
|
160 |
output_midi_summary = gr.Textbox(label="Output MIDI summary")
|
@@ -163,26 +163,16 @@ if __name__ == "__main__":
|
|
163 |
output_midi = gr.File(label="Output MIDI file", file_types=[".mid"])
|
164 |
|
165 |
|
166 |
-
run_event = run_btn.click(
|
167 |
[output_midi_title, output_midi_summary, output_midi, output_audio, output_plot])
|
168 |
|
169 |
gr.Examples(
|
170 |
-
[["
|
171 |
-
["
|
172 |
-
["Chords-Progressions-Transformer-Piano-Seed-3.mid", 128, "Chords-Times-Durations", False],
|
173 |
-
["Chords-Progressions-Transformer-Piano-Seed-4.mid", 128, "Chords", False],
|
174 |
-
["Chords-Progressions-Transformer-Piano-Seed-5.mid", 128, "Chords-Times", False],
|
175 |
-
["Chords-Progressions-Transformer-Piano-Seed-6.mid", 128, "Chords-Times-Durations", False],
|
176 |
-
["Chords-Progressions-Transformer-MI-Seed-1.mid", 128, "Chords", False],
|
177 |
-
["Chords-Progressions-Transformer-MI-Seed-2.mid", 128, "Chords-Times", False],
|
178 |
-
["Chords-Progressions-Transformer-MI-Seed-3.mid", 128, "Chords-Times-Durations", False],
|
179 |
-
["Chords-Progressions-Transformer-MI-Seed-4.mid", 128, "Chords-Times", False],
|
180 |
-
["Chords-Progressions-Transformer-MI-Seed-5.mid", 128, "Chords", False],
|
181 |
-
["Chords-Progressions-Transformer-MI-Seed-6.mid", 128, "Chords-Times-Durations", False]
|
182 |
],
|
183 |
-
[input_midi,
|
184 |
[output_midi_title, output_midi_summary, output_midi, output_audio, output_plot],
|
185 |
-
|
186 |
cache_examples=True,
|
187 |
)
|
188 |
|
|
|
152 |
input_patch = gr.Slider(0, 127, value=40, step=1, label="Melody MIDI patch")
|
153 |
input_start_chord = gr.Slider(0, 128, value=0, step=1, label="Melody start chord")
|
154 |
|
155 |
+
run_btn = gr.Button("add melody", variant="primary")
|
156 |
|
157 |
+
gr.Markdown("## Output results")
|
158 |
|
159 |
output_midi_title = gr.Textbox(label="Output MIDI title")
|
160 |
output_midi_summary = gr.Textbox(label="Output MIDI summary")
|
|
|
163 |
output_midi = gr.File(label="Output MIDI file", file_types=[".mid"])
|
164 |
|
165 |
|
166 |
+
run_event = run_btn.click(AddMelody, [input_midi, input_channel, input_patch, input_start_chord],
|
167 |
[output_midi_title, output_midi_summary, output_midi, output_audio, output_plot])
|
168 |
|
169 |
gr.Examples(
|
170 |
+
[["Sharing The Night Together.kar", 3, 40, 0],
|
171 |
+
["Deep Relaxation Melody #6.mid", 3, 40, 0],
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
172 |
],
|
173 |
+
[input_midi, input_channel, input_patch, input_start_chord],
|
174 |
[output_midi_title, output_midi_summary, output_midi, output_audio, output_plot],
|
175 |
+
AddMelody,
|
176 |
cache_examples=True,
|
177 |
)
|
178 |
|